ABSTRACT:
An optical wavelength converter device is of the fiber type including a cladding and a core surrounded by the cladding, the cladding having a lower refractive index than the refractive index of the core. The optical wavelength converter device serves to convert a fundamental wave into a secondary harmonic wave. The cladding has an exit end surface shaped for converting the wavefront of a wavelength-converted wave from the conical wavefront into a planar or spherical wavefront. A optical wavelength converter system comprises such an optical wavelength converter device and an optical device for diffractively or refractively converting the wavefront of the wavelength-converted wave from a conical wavefront into a planar or spherical wavefront.
